Transaction 52625977f42bc6affe7845b117bb9602a8080e37947884dae79e5c54150a25d3

2 Input
2 Outputs
  • 52625977f42bc6affe7845b117bb9602a8080e37947884dae79e5c54150a25d3:0
  • value  12139999
    address  33rdizWJvDAmv4WqSGQGD9sHDrWTLsX34U
  • 52625977f42bc6affe7845b117bb9602a8080e37947884dae79e5c54150a25d3:1
  • value  61573304
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9